At Northeast Alabama Community College, 1,296 undergraduate students (45% of total 2,905 students) have received financial aid including grants, scholarships, and/or federal student loans. The average amount of aid received is $5,670.
| Type of Aid | Number Receiving Aid | Percent Receiving Aid | Total Amount of Aid Received | Average Amount of Aid Received |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Grant or Scholarship | 1,296 | 45% | $7,348,186 | $5,670 |
| Pell Grants | 993 | 34% | $5,630,927 | $5,671 |
| Federal Student Loan | 347 | 12% | $1,263,861 | $3,642 |
350 beginning undergraduate students (93% of total 377 enrolled freshmen) have received financial aid including grants, scholarships, and/or federal student loans at Northeast Alabama Community College. The average amount of aid received is $7,271.
| Type of Aid | Number Receiving Aid | Percent Receiving Aid | Total Amount of Aid Received | Average Amount of Aid Received |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Any Financial Aid | 350 | 93% | - | - |
| Grants or Scholarships | 338 | 90% | $2,457,483 | $7,271 |
| Federal Grants | 249 | 66% | $1,777,531 | $7,139 |
| Pell Grants | 249 | 66% | $1,744,724 | $7,007 |
| Other Federal Grants | 26 | 7% | $32,807 | $1,262 |
| State/Local Grants | 38 | 10% | $30,600 | $805 |
| Institutional Grants | 185 | 49% | $649,352 | $3,510 |
| Student Loan Aid | 59 | 16% | $189,532 | $3,212 |
| Federal Student Loans | 59 | 16% | $189,532 | $3,212 |
| Other Student Loans | - | - | - | - |
The following table shows the number of students awarded and the average grants / scholarship aid amount by income level for the academic year 2023-2024 at Northeast Alabama Community College.
The sources of grants and scholarship aid are the federal government, state/local government, or the institution. For the statistics, only students who paid the in-state or in-district tuition rate are considered.
| Income Level | Number of Students | Number of Students Awarded | Total Amount Aid Awarded | Average Amount Aid Awarded |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| All level | 304 | 295 | $2,738,564 | $9,008 |
| 0-30,000 | 158 | 158 | $1,636,952 | $10,360 |
| 30,001-48,000 | 70 | 70 | $655,355 | $9,362 |
| 48,001-75,000 | 57 | 54 | $409,189 | $7,179 |
| 75,001-110,000 | 13 | 8 | $31,452 | $2,419 |
| 110,001 or more | 6 | 5 | $5,616 | $936 |
